Well, the Hijri date 24 Shawwal 1436 corresponds to the Gregorian date Sunday, 9 August 2015. This date lies in the tenth month of the Hijri year 1436 AH, which is Shawwal of 1436 AH. Both this Hijri and Gregorian date occur on the single day that is Sunday without any doubt. The Arabic date 1436/10/24 is calculated using the Umm Al-Qura calendar and the sighting of the moon. One thing to remember is that this Arabic date may occur on different Gregorian date depending upon the region and country and obviously the moon.

Sahih al-Bukhari
Belief
Chapter: Faith increases and decreases
Narrated Anas:
The Prophet (ﷺ) said, "Whoever said "None has the right to be worshipped but Allah and has in his heart good (faith) equal to the weight of a barley grain will be taken out of Hell. And whoever said: "None has the right to be worshipped but Allah and has in his heart good (faith) equal to the weight of a wheat grain will be taken out of Hell. And whoever said, "None has the right to be worshipped but Allah and has in his heart good (faith) equal to the weight of an atom will be taken out of Hell."
Sahih al-Bukhari 44
